How to use the timeline
Each entry records what the developer announced and the practical system it affects. A fix means the named case was addressed; it does not prove that every similar symptom has disappeared. A roadmap statement means the team acknowledged or plans work; it is not listed as shipped until a later Directive confirms the change.
Keep AppID boundaries intact. Demo 1069590, Prologue 4107120, Playtest 2194080, and Prologue Playtest 4150700 are separate products. Patch behavior from one of them should not be inserted into a base-game guide without current AppID 1067360 confirmation.

2026-08-15 - Directive AG-14 expands capture tools
Type: Gameplay and hotfix update
The developer added three advanced Capture Rounds. A target now receives temporary protection from death after a failed capture attempt, but the Leader’s melee attack bypasses that protection. This distinction changes capture discipline: players should use the protected moment to stop attacks and reset position rather than continue striking the target.
- Vortex Shell damage was increased.
- Thunderbolt Arrow received a larger area of effect.
- Saves can be sorted, including by most recently used.
- The soldier deployment menu received a 16:10 resolution fix.
- Resource hauling, Trade Port prices, wall behavior, and other colony cases received fixes.
- The note describes an attempted fix for an FSR-related crash and corrects wrong pregnancy states associated with Mandatory Reproduction.
Source: Official Directive AG-14
2026-08-13 - State of the Frontline identifies priorities
Type: Development status and support guidance
The team summarized player pain points around capture and conversion, expedition repetition, soldier behavior, guidance, performance, and crashes. These items are acknowledged work areas, not all completed changes. The post also gives the current official sequence for players experiencing crashes.
- Verify the installed files through Steam.
- Disable DLSS Super Resolution.
- Disable Frame Generation.
- Contact the official Discord support community if the crash remains.
- The post discusses aging control, backups, exile, and deposit handling as delivered quality-of-life work.
Source: Official State of the Frontline
2026-08-12 - Directive AG-12 adds recovery and colony controls
Type: Feature and stability update
AG-12 added a setting to disable aging, manual exile, automatic save backups, and quantity selection when depositing items. Those changes affect long-term population planning, policy actions, recovery safety, and resource allocation. The update also reduced the difficulty of Infested Nests and improved soldier upgrades.
- Prison research time changed, so older fixed-duration advice should be rechecked.
- Several crash cases received fixes, including an FSR Frame Generation issue in borderless mode.
- Command Center and Victory Square research states received repair-related corrections.
- The Serina boss indicator was fixed.
- Players should retain the automatic backup rather than using destructive save troubleshooting.
Source: Official Directive AG-12
2026-08-11 - Initial maintenance addresses progression blockers
Type: Launch maintenance
The first maintenance notes addressed saving failures, an Office softlock, quest-count problems, and a Toxic Fog Core interaction with the Tree of Asherah. These narrow fixes are important when reading launch-day reports: a symptom captured before maintenance may not reproduce on the present branch.
- Recheck a blocked objective after confirming Steam completed the update.
- Do not generalize the named Toxic Fog interaction into a universal core ranking.
- Preserve the exact mission and save state when a progression problem continues.
Source: Official Pax Autocratica Steam News
2026-08-10 - Pax Autocratica enters Early Access
Type: Release milestone
The base game became available in Steam Early Access for Windows. The public loop combines colony construction and production, citizen and policy management, tactical expeditions, soldiers, combat, capture, and prisoner conversion. Early Access status means systems and balance can continue to change through developer Directives.
- The Steam listing supports single-player play, full controllers, Steam Cloud, and saving at any time.
- The public requirements list DirectX 11, 16 GB RAM, and 40 GB storage.
- Guides on this site use AppID 1067360 and do not inherit status from related applications.
Source: Pax Autocratica on Steam
After an update installs
Read the official note, retain a pre-update save, and test the system named by the change in a small controlled case. For capture, use an ordinary target; for a weapon core, keep the user and encounter consistent; for colony logistics, watch one complete delivery; for a crash fix, repeat the shortest known reproduction.
When behavior differs from this tracker, the later official Directive and the live AppID 1067360 interface take priority. Use Crash Fixes for stability problems, Combat for changed battle behavior, and Colony for resource or building issues.
